Summary: | This book is intended for Engineers and Applied Scientists who are not specialising in electronics or computing, but who are using microcomputers in experimental or project work. It provides a very practical guide to the use of micros for measurement and control of signals in both industrial and laboratory applications. The book also provides circuit diagrams and component specifications for a wealth of proven signal conditioning and transducer circuits, together with the necessary interfacing information. The fundamental principles behind data acquisition, signal conditioning and interfacing are clearly explained so that readers will be able to apply them effectively to their own measurement problems |
